Allergies can develop later in life;this is not really a common allergy symptom from dairy products,but is possible.It could be exposure to something else that you are eating or in your environment at the same time.Try not having those food items,but eating/drinking other things in the same place where you have been sneezing.If no sneezing,then reintroduce to see if returns.Call your doctor also

This is not the usual way that a food allergy would present, but it is possible. I would keep track of when it happens in relationship to dairy and two other foods that you eat with it, and set up a follow up visit with your primary care doctor to discuss this. Good luck.
